From the FAQ:

Q: What sort of functionality will there be for the creation of custom content and will this impact the community packs?

A: Our intention is that you will be able to add your own custom content. Support for user-created data files to augment existing game systems has been designed into everything, as that capability is critical to the success of various game systems we currently support. That said, the details of exactly how and when that will be made available within Hero Lab Online are still being worked out. This primarily impacts the existing game systems in Hero Lab Classic, so we’ll address this topic in detail when we migrate those game systems to Hero Lab Online.


There's only a little I can add at the moment...

We're not going to be changing the fundamental structure of existing game systems. Doing that would have massive ripple effects into all the custom content that everyone has created.

New game systems will be optimized for Hero Lab Online. Case in point being Starfinder. And that means there will be lots of work involved to support Classic, as well - as I outlined above.

The huge change to game systems is the UI when going between Classic and Online. All of the internal structure will remain basically unchanged.

There should be an Editor in Online, just like there is in Classic, for adding new content.

Things get vastly more complicated with Online when it comes to sharing custom creations. We've got stuff mapped out, but it still needs refinement and there could be gotchas we haven't yet thought of. So we're not giving out concrete details until we're certain of everything.
